В современном мире точность расчётов играет ключевую роль в финансовой деятельности любой компании. Даже небольшая погрешность в сумме может привести к потере доверия клиентов, штрафам и непредвиденным расходам. Поэтому важно понимать, какие факторы чаще всего приводят к поломке калькулятора для списания и как их избежать. Ниже мы разберём десять главных причин, которые могут нарушить работу вашего калькуляционного инструмента, и предложим практические решения, чтобы сохранить расчёты в надёжном и точном состоянии.
1. Неправильная настройка валютных коэффициентов
Калькуляторы для списания часто используют коэффициенты для конвертации валют. Если эти коэффициенты заданы неверно или не обновляются в соответствии с текущими курсами, расчёты будут искажены. Регулярная проверка и актуализация коэффициентов, а также автоматическое подключение к надёжному источнику валютных курсов помогут избежать подобных ошибок.
2. Ошибки в формуле расчёта налогов
Налоги могут изменяться в зависимости от региона, типа операции и статуса клиента. Если формулы налоговых расчётов не отражают актуальные законодательные изменения, калькулятор выдаст неверные суммы. Внедрение системы обновления налоговых правил и проверка формул на тестовых данных обеспечит корректность итоговых значений.
3. Проблемы с округлением чисел
Округление – частый источник погрешностей. Если калькулятор применяет разные правила округления для разных операций (например, округление до целого для одной строки и до сотых для другой), итоговые суммы могут не совпадать с ожидаемыми. Установите единый стандарт округления и применяйте его последовательно во всех расчетах.
4. Неправильная обработка отрицательных значений
Отрицательные суммы могут возникать при возвратах, скидках или ошибках в вводе. Если калькулятор не корректно обрабатывает такие значения, это приводит к неверному итоговому балансу. Тестируйте сценарии с отрицательными числами и убедитесь, что они учитываются в расчётах без ошибок.
5. Проблемы с кэшированием данных
Кэширование может ускорить работу калькулятора, но если кэш не очищается после обновления данных, калькулятор будет использовать устаревшие значения. Настройте механизм автоматического сброса кэша при изменении ключевых параметров, чтобы гарантировать актуальность расчётов.
6. Неправильная работа с дробными числами в разных системах счисления
При работе с разными системами счисления (десятичной, двоичной, шестнадцатеричной) могут возникать ошибки преобразования. Убедитесь, что калькулятор корректно преобразует числа между системами и сохраняет точность при каждом преобразовании.
7. Ошибки в логике применения скидок и бонусов
Скидки и бонусы часто применяются по сложным правилам, зависящим от статуса клиента, объёма заказа и других факторов. Если логика применения этих скидок реализована неверно, итоговая сумма будет искажена. Проведите ревизию правил скидок и протестируйте их на различных сценариях.
8. Проблемы с синхронизацией данных между системами
Калькулятор может получать данные из нескольких источников: ERP, CRM, банковские системы. Если данные не синхронизированы должным образом, калькулятор может использовать несогласованные значения. Внедрите единый протокол обмена данными и регулярно проверяйте целостность синхронизированных данных.
9. Недостаточная проверка входных данных
Если калькулятор принимает некорректные или неполные данные без проверки, это приводит к ошибочным расчётам. Реализуйте строгую валидацию входных данных: проверяйте диапазоны, типы, обязательные поля и корректность форматов.
10. Отсутствие резервного копирования и восстановления
В случае сбоя или потери данных без резервного копирования калькулятор может вернуть неверные результаты или потерять данные полностью. Настройте регулярное резервное копирование всех конфигураций и данных, а также процедуру восстановления, чтобы быстро вернуть систему в рабочее состояние.
Итак, чтобы ваш калькулятор для списания работал надёжно и точно, необходимо внимательно следить за настройками валют, налогов, округления, отрицательных значений, кэширования, систем счисления, скидок, синхронизации данных, валидацией входных данных и резервным копированием. Применяя эти рекомендации, вы сможете избежать распространённых ошибок и сохранить точность расчётов, что в конечном итоге укрепит доверие ваших клиентов и повысит эффективность финансовых процессов вашей компании.